RMA Procedure
An RMA (Return of Merchandise Authorisation) number gives you permission to send back goods which are supplied incorrectly, or need to be repaired. We need to be able to link the incoming product with a customer. This is done with the RMA number.
To avoid the situation where you send us a non-defective device, we advise you to search through our FAQ pages to see if the answer to your problem is listed there. If these pages do not offer any solution, contact us to see if we can solve the problem. If this fails too, you can fill in the RMA form.
The procedure is as follows: you fill in the RMA-form and click ‘send’. Then our RMA department processes your request, and sends you an authorization form with RMA number and shipping address. This form must accompany the product that you send back to us.
Within 3 weeks, you will be notified of the status of repair of your returned product. If you have not heard anything after 3weeks, please contact us.

RMA Conditions
An RMA device will only be accepted as such when the following procedures have been followed and conditions have been met. If not, returned goods will not be accepted.
• Merchandise must be offered at risk and costs of owner, unless agreed otherwise;
• Merchandise must be accompanied by a filled in RMA form;
• The RMA number must clearly be stated on the RMA form and outer box;
• Merchandise must be shipped in appropriate packaging. When shipped without appropriate packaging, the warranty is void;
• Merchandise must be returned in original, undamaged packaging. Without this, we do not accept the shipment and the merchandise is sent back.
